Welcome to our Agile FAQ section! 🌟 Whether you're new to Agile or looking to deepen your understanding, here are some common questions and answers to help you navigate the world of Agile methodologies.

What is Agile Development?

Agile is a flexible and iterative approach to software development that emphasizes collaboration, customer feedback, and rapid delivery.

Agile Methodology

Learn more about Agile basics: Agile Introduction

Key Concepts of Agile

  • Sprints: Time-boxed periods (usually 2-4 weeks) for completing specific work.
    Scrum Framework
  • Backlog: A prioritized list of tasks, requirements, and features.
  • Daily Standups: Short meetings to sync team progress and address blockers.
  • User Stories: Descriptions of features from the end-user's perspective.
    User Stories

Common Challenges

  • Scope Creep: Uncontrolled changes to project scope.
  • Communication Gaps: Misalignment between stakeholders and teams.
  • Adoption Hurdles: Transitioning from traditional methods like Waterfall.
    Waterfall vs Agile

Why Choose Agile?

  • 🔄 Adaptability: Responds to changing requirements quickly.
  • 🤝 Collaboration: Encourages cross-functional teamwork.
  • 📈 Transparency: Regular updates keep everyone informed.
    Agile Benefits

For deeper insights, explore our Agile Resources page! 📚